Why Heat-Resistant Silicone Resins Are Essential
High heat destroys unprotected surfaces. BBQ grills blister under flames, while industrial machinery overheats during operations. Standard coatings fail quickly, leading to costly repairs. Heat-resistant silicone resins form a flexible, adhesive barrier that handles temperatures up to 600°F (315°C) or higher. They resist thermal shock, moisture, and chemicals, making them ideal for grills, ovens, engines, and factory equipment. Without them, frequent replacements and safety hazards become inevitable.

Types of Heat-Resistant Silicone Resins

  1. High-Temperature Silicone Coatings: Ideal for grills, exhaust systems, and furnaces.
  2. Food-Grade Silicone Resins: Safe for BBQ grills and food-processing equipment.
  3. Flexible Silicone Elastomers: Perfect for parts needing vibration resistance.
  4. Industrial-Grade Resins: Built for heavy machinery in harsh environments.

Choose based on your needs—grill owners might pick food-grade, while factories need industrial-grade.

Application Tips for Maximum Performance

  1. Clean Thoroughly: Remove grease, rust, and old coatings.
  2. Use Primer: Improves adhesion on tricky surfaces like aluminum.
  3. Apply Thin Layers: Multiple coats prevent drips and ensure even coverage.
  4. Cure Properly: Follow time and temperature guidelines for hardening.

Skipping steps leads to peeling or uneven protection.
